Frequently Asked Questions

What are the vaccination requirements for my pet to attend daycare in Bronston?

Most reputable daycares in Bronston and Pulaski County require proof of up-to-date vaccinations for the safety of all pets. This typically includes Rabies, DHPP (for dogs), and Bordetella (kennel cough). Many facilities also now require a negative fecal test to prevent the spread of parasites. Always check with your chosen daycare for their specific list, and you can get these vaccines from local vets like Bronston Animal Clinic or a nearby practice in Somerset.

How much does dog daycare typically cost in Bronston, Kentucky?

In the Bronston area, you can expect to pay between $20 to $30 for a full day of daycare. Many facilities also offer half-day options for around $15 to $20. Some providers may offer discounted multi-day packages. Prices are generally competitive with those in nearby Somerset, but it's always best to contact the daycare directly for their most current rates and any promotions for new customers.

What should I bring for my pet's first day of daycare?

For a successful first day, bring your dog on a secure leash and collar (a flat buckle collar is best, avoid choke or prong collars). You should also provide your pet's food if they require a meal during the day, along with any necessary medications with clear written instructions. While most daycares provide bowls, beds, and toys, you can bring a comfort item from home if it's labeled. Do not bring rawhides or other high-value chews that could cause possessiveness.

Do you offer outdoor play areas, and how do you handle Kentucky's variable weather?

Yes, many pet daycares in the Bronston area feature secure outdoor play yards so dogs can enjoy fresh air and more space to run. However, given Kentucky's hot and humid summers and occasionally cold, wet winters, facilities are equipped with climate-controlled indoor spaces. Playtime is carefully managed to avoid overheating in summer, and dogs have access to plenty of shade and fresh water. On days with severe weather, all activities are moved indoors to ensure safety.

Before you commit, a visit is non-negotiable. A good daycare will welcome a meet-and-greet. Pay attention to the cleanliness of the space, the temperament of the other dogs, and the staff's genuine interest in your pet's needs. Ask about their routine: is there a balance of play and rest? How do they handle different energy levels? For our active Bronston pups who might be used to roaming big yards, ensuring they have adequate outdoor time and space is key.
